The Simple Gift, a new by Steven Herrick, will be based upon the trip of a teenage boy known as Billy. The book highlights that materials possessions aren’t all that matters, and that often it is a sense of belonging that basically shines through during eager times. At times money even if earnt could be valueless, freedom can be found simpler if you shortage physical assets, and simply allowing go in the past and leaving it behind can lead to you obtaining happiness through better, more powerful relationships.

Quite often people seeking that belong see zero ultimate worth in cash. Billy reveals us this in the book if he buys Caitlin a ring immediately after receiving his pay. He feels he has no genuine desire to maintain your money, although he worked his ass off most weak to earn that. In his brain the work was going to cure dullness, and he would much somewhat spend the thing that was considered correctly his in someone else; showing how much he really cares for you.

In return this act of closeness towards Caitlin gave him a sense of that belong.

During the book Caitlin often talks about just how Billy has it better as they lacks the physical belongings that make you set in life. This might be true, but also for Billy getting to this stage forced him to eliminate pretty much almost all his physical possessions. “As dad was over myself, and said, no more sport, no more permanently.  The relevance on this quote with this paragraph could be questioned, however it signifies two physical possessions of Billy before he left home, sport, great father.

Those two possessions are definitely the main reason so why Billy left and played a strong role in his decision. His daddy took away his love of sport, between many other points, and when Billy realized that it had been getting an excessive amount of for him, he forgotten the couple of remaining things he continue to cared for; Bunkbrain his doggie was most challenging for him to keep. Billy in that case arrived in Bendarat with nothing; he needed a fresh start, with practically nothing. Sometimes should you fail to proceed from the previous you can turn into stuck in a continuous circuit for the rest of your daily life.

Old Bill is a character from The Simple Gift which clearly illustrates this circuit; he is left with the burden of his little girl’s tragic fatality, and his better half passing away specifically a year after. These occasions in his lifestyle caused him to become relatively depressed, in which he healed or more accurately buried through drinking alcohol. His horrible obsession with alcohol afflicted his daily life, as he can no longer stand to live in his home, this individual moved into a vintage train buggy near the station.

One day he met Billy, whom he absolutely resented, though he knew that Billy will do him good. His or her relationship turns into stronger he realizes that Billy appears up to him, and that he should certainly try to get a better function model. Slowly and gradually Billy and Old Bill form a father and son type bond, which usually does them both good, but also in the end Older Bill leaves Bill to make an improved life pertaining to himself when he knows if perhaps he stays in Bendarat e are never able to release he previous.

The key reason for Old Bill’s moving on is giving the keys to his property to Billy, so he can start a your life with Caitlin. This enabling go is key to new chapters in both Billy’s and Outdated Bill’s lives; chapters with happiness, and belonging. In summary The Simple Present covers various aspects, some of which are stated above, that clearly format and expand the idea of belonging, and how at times the feeling of belonging way overrules all material possessions.
